4

Interactive Broker に含まれているコード サンプルを実行しようとしています。

http://www.interactivebrokers.com/download/JavaAPIGettingStarted.pdf

約 42 ページに、市場データ フィードを取得する方法が詳しく説明されています。私の質問は、通貨ペアのデータを取得するために必要なパラメーターをうまく入力した人はいますか??

 public synchronized void reqMktData(int tickerId, Contract contract, String genericTickList, boolean snapshot)

クライアントから見たエラーを修正する有効な入力が見つかりません。

必要なパラメータ

Contract クラス内の値のリストはこちら: https://www.interactivebrokers.com/en/software/api/apiguide/java/contract.htm

STK == "stock" 、これは外国為替データの CASH に設定する必要がありますか?

IDEALPRO == このページによる交換: http://ibkb.interactivebrokers.com/tag/fx-trader

USD.JPY = SYMBOL (これは私の推測です)

USD == "基になる通貨" 、ここでもう一度推測します..通貨は取引通貨と一致する必要があるようです。

トランザクション通貨.決済通貨の形式のペア (例: EUR.USD)。Underlying 列には、取引通貨のみが表示されます。

入力のダイアログ ボックス

4

2 に答える 2

0

私が覚えているように、私は以下を使用しました: CASH, IDEALPRO, EUR.USD,USD

TradeStation クライアントですべてのパラメータの例を確認できます。必要な楽器を見つけて、そのプロパティを確認するだけです。

また、必ずしもすべてのパラメータを入力する必要があるわけではないことに注意してください

最悪の場合、エラーを表示します。

于 2014-01-14T06:37:19.610 に答える